The story of recovery: I’m the environment protector

“Hurry! Hurry!” Haw-haw and Dong-dong walk to the school festival together. Two little children is walking in the school festival very quickly. They are afraid of missing any single vendor because they are too slow. At this moment, Shuan-shuan takes her parents to walk around every vendor. She buys every hot and cold drink. Shuan-shuan’s mother tells her: “Don’t buy too much! It wastes money and hurt your stomach.” Her mother’s talk didn’t have too much effect to Shuan-shuan. This is different to Jun-jun who always stay clean. Jun-jun and her friends is observing what are the different attractive points to all the vendors? It is impossible for Jun-jun to buy things because she is afraid of getting sick. Kuan-kuan likes to save money, so he will not buy things.

The school festival is over in the afternoon, and the parents are leaving. Students are cleaning up the mess.
Kuan-kuan and his classmates go back to the classroom. “Wow! The two trash cans are all full. There is also some trash behind the trash cans!” Jun-jun sees and screams: “Wait! Where will you dump the trash?”

Haw-haw says: “The garbage truck! And then the garbage truck will take the garbage away.”
Jun-jun says unhappily: “No! No!”
Haw-haw explains: “What’s wrong? The trash will be dumped in the garbage truck absolutely!”


“This is the report from the office: Attention every class! The garbage today is much more than usual. More over, most of the people didn’t sort the garbage and it will cause problems like the recyclable trash will be dumped into the garbage truck. So every student please spends some time to sort the garbage first.” The clear report stops Jun-jun and Haw-haw’s quarrel.

“Good job students! I think everyone heard the report from the office. I’m going to explain how to sort the garbage and the importance of sorting the garbage.” The teacher says this after he gets in the classroom.

Everyone is listening carefully to the teacher. Especially Jun-jun and Haw-haw who had a quarrel because of it.

The teacher says: “The school is promoting the trash reducing action. The trash reducing action means to encourage everyone to recycle the garbage.” Kuan-kuan is still confused; he raises his hands and asks: “What kind of garbage can be recycled? What kinds of garbage have to be dumped away?”

The teacher smiles and says: “This is a good question! We sort the trash into two kinds: one is recyclable and another one is non-recyclable trash. Non-recyclable trash is our trash, the trash will be sent by the garbage truck. Recyclable trash is the trash that can be used after some treatment.” Haw-haw realized and says thank you to the teacher. Then he apologized to Jun-jun.

“Now let’s pull out all of the trash and learn how to sort the trash.” The teacher walks to the trash can after he says this. He takes a plastic bottle, a carton box, and a plastic cup. He says to the students: “These are all recyclable trash. Actually there are so many recyclable trashes. The cans, paper, and waste batteries. You have to see them clearly! They have the recyclable marks on them.” “OK! Now let’s do it!”


“Teacher, is glass recyclable?” Dung-dung asks. “Teacher, is it OK if the bottle still left some drink?” Haw-haw asks immediately. The teacher answers: “Glasses are recyclable. But remember to clean it up before you put it into the trash can!”

Everyone sort out the garbage after a while. They find out that the non-recyclable trash can is only half-full! The recyclable trash is all full! Kuan-kuan says with excitement: “Recycling is just like magic! The non-recyclable trash disappears a lot!”

The teacher praises students: “You did a great job! Not only save time, but also sort out the garbage carefully. Look! The garbage is less than before. At the same time, you can help the people responsible for the trash dumping. Now wash your hands. Let’s take the garbage to the garbage field and learn how to sort out the recyclable trash ok?” The students are so happy and go out to make a line outside the classroom.
